Re: [問題] Pushbutton 的 makeEntity

看板Flash作者 (waliliadai)時間14年前 (2010/07/11 01:00), 編輯推噓0(003)
留言3則, 2人參與, 最新討論串3/3 (看更多)
我發現了一件詭異的事 我分別用三種paramas positionReference = new PropertyReference("@Spatial.position"); 1.PBE.makeEntity(spawnType, { positionReference: ..} ); 2.PBE.makeEntity(spawnType, { (new PropertyReference("@Spatial.position"):...}): 3.PBE.makeEntity(spawnType, { "@Spatial.position": ...} ) 雖然paramas[key]都為正常的值,可是三個key的類型都被判別為String for(var key:* in paramas)裡面的key好像全部都變成String了 更奇怪的地方是,用第二種方法的key會是"@Spatial.position" 可是用第一種方會卻又變成"positionReference" -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 123.192.65.51

07/11 01:09, , 1F
那就是了,看makeEntity()內部就可以了解為什麼會出錯了
07/11 01:09, 1F

07/11 01:09, , 2F
就用可以正常運作的方法去開發吧 :)
07/11 01:09, 2F

07/11 08:25, , 3F
謝謝:)
07/11 08:25, 3F
文章代碼(AID): #1CEASphY (Flash)
文章代碼(AID): #1CEASphY (Flash)